Output eac78610f03ad8bc5f59c9645fe95ab2332a2113a38b6389cac0dd254784035b:0

value
261344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ed781b731248159023d8283a4e38cc497633c17d OP_EQUAL
address
3PLdxCmwG9Tbb7h4yq91eLU2Y8o9nf6Ppv
transaction
eac78610f03ad8bc5f59c9645fe95ab2332a2113a38b6389cac0dd254784035b
confirmations
271309
spent
true